当前位置: 首页 > news >正文

5个颠覆性自动化实战技巧:彻底改变你的数字工作流

5个颠覆性自动化实战技巧:彻底改变你的数字工作流

【免费下载链接】KeymouseGo类似按键精灵的鼠标键盘录制和自动化操作 模拟点击和键入 | automate mouse clicks and keyboard input项目地址: https://gitcode.com/gh_mirrors/ke/KeymouseGo

每天重复点击同一个按钮,机械地填写相同表单,在多个平台间切换执行相同操作——这些看似微不足道的数字劳动,正在悄悄吞噬你的创造力和时间。如果你每天花30分钟在这些重复性任务上,一年就是182.5小时,相当于整整7.6天。现在,有一款开源工具正在悄然改变这一现状,它不要求你学习编程,不需要复杂配置,只需按下录制键,就能让计算机记住你的每一个动作,并在需要时完美复现。

这款名为KeymouseGo的鼠标键盘自动化工具,正在成为效率追求者的秘密武器。它像一位不知疲倦的数字助手,忠实地记录你的操作流程,然后以毫米级精度重复执行。无论你是需要批量处理文档的办公室职员,还是需要自动化测试的开发者,或是想要简化日常操作的技术爱好者,这款工具都能将你从重复劳动中解放出来。

你的时间应该用在刀刃上,而不是重复点击上

想象一下这样的场景:每天早上打开电脑,第一件事就是登录五个不同的系统,点击相同的菜单,填写相同的表格。这种重复性工作不仅枯燥乏味,还容易出错。更糟糕的是,它占用了你本可以用于创造性思考的时间。

KeymouseGo的解决方案简单而强大——录制一次,无限复用。它的工作原理就像给计算机安装了一个"肌肉记忆"系统。当你执行某个操作流程时,它会精确记录每个鼠标点击的位置、每次键盘敲击的时机,以及所有操作之间的时间间隔。然后,你可以随时回放这个流程,让计算机以完全相同的节奏重复你的动作。

图:KeymouseGo v5.1主界面 - 简洁直观的鼠标键盘自动化控制中心

这款工具的核心优势在于其极简主义设计哲学。不需要复杂的脚本编写,不需要学习新的编程语言,只需要像平常一样操作电脑,然后按下录制键。这种"所见即所得"的自动化方式,让技术门槛降到了最低。

3个层级的时间解放策略:从分钟级到天级的效率革命

第一层:分钟级自动化 - 日常操作的即时解放

这一层针对那些每天重复数十次的小操作。比如:

  • 登录系统时的账号密码输入
  • 邮件客户端中的重复性操作
  • 文件管理中的批量重命名和移动
  • 社交媒体平台的日常发布流程

这些操作单个看似微不足道,但累积起来却消耗惊人。KeymouseGo的解决方案是创建"微脚本"——只针对特定小任务的自动化流程。每个微脚本可能只节省你30秒,但当你有20个这样的脚本时,每天就能节省10分钟,一年就是60小时。

实战技巧:创建你的第一个自动化脚本

  1. 启动KeymouseGo程序
  2. 点击"录制"按钮开始记录
  3. 执行你想要自动化的操作序列
  4. 点击"结束"按钮完成录制
  5. 给脚本命名并保存

现在,每当需要执行这个操作序列时,只需选择脚本并点击"启动"。你可以设置执行次数,甚至设置为无限循环,让计算机在后台默默工作。

第二层:小时级自动化 - 工作流程的系统优化

当基础操作自动化后,你可以开始整合更大的工作流程。这一层关注的是那些需要多个步骤、跨应用协作的复杂任务。例如:

  • 数据收集、整理、分析到报告的完整流程
  • 跨平台的内容发布和同步
  • 定期的系统维护和数据备份

KeymouseGo的高级功能在这里大显身手。通过编辑生成的JSON5格式脚本,你可以精确调整每个步骤的时间间隔,添加条件等待,甚至创建复杂的操作链。脚本存储在scripts目录下,采用人类可读的格式,便于理解和修改。

{ scripts: [ // 等待系统启动完成 {type: "event", event_type: "EM", delay: 5000, action_type: "mouse left down", action: ["0.15%", "0.20%"]}, // 执行登录操作 {type: "event", event_type: "EX", delay: 100, action_type: "input", action: "your_username"}, // 切换字段并输入密码 {type: "event", event_type: "EK", delay: 200, action_type: "key down", action: [9, 'Tab', 0]}, {type: "event", event_type: "EX", delay: 100, action_type: "input", action: "your_password"}, // 点击登录按钮 {type: "event", event_type: "EM", delay: 300, action_type: "mouse left down", action: ["0.45%", "0.55%"]} ] }

第三层:天级自动化 - 业务过程的全面重构

最高层级的自动化涉及整个业务过程的重新设计。这时,KeymouseGo不再仅仅是工具,而是成为工作流程的核心组件。你可以:

  1. 创建自动化工作队列:将多个脚本串联,形成完整的工作流
  2. 集成系统调度:配合操作系统的任务计划程序,实现定时自动执行
  3. 建立错误处理机制:通过脚本编辑添加容错逻辑
  4. 开发监控和报告系统:记录自动化执行的结果和异常

这一层级需要更深入的技术理解,但回报也最为丰厚。一个设计良好的天级自动化系统,可以将原本需要数小时的手动工作压缩到几分钟内完成。

跨平台适应性:为什么显示设置如此重要

自动化工具的核心挑战之一是如何在不同环境下保持一致性。KeymouseGo采用相对坐标系统来解决这个问题——它记录的是屏幕位置的百分比,而不是绝对像素值。这意味着同一个脚本可以在不同分辨率的显示器上运行。

然而,要达到最佳效果,显示设置的正确配置至关重要。特别是显示缩放比例,这直接影响到鼠标定位的精度。

图:Windows系统显示缩放设置界面 - 为确保鼠标键盘自动化精度,建议将系统显示缩放设置为100%

关键配置建议:

  • 显示缩放:设置为100%以获得最精确的坐标映射
  • 分辨率:尽量使用相同的分辨率进行录制和回放
  • 多显示器:确保主显示器设置一致
  • DPI设置:保持系统DPI设置为默认值

这些设置虽然看似技术细节,但它们决定了自动化脚本能否在不同环境下稳定运行。特别是对于需要跨设备、跨环境部署的自动化流程,正确的显示配置是成功的基础。

实战场景:从理论到应用的效率飞跃

场景一:内容创作者的批量发布流水线

如果你是内容创作者,每天需要在多个平台发布相同内容,KeymouseGo可以创建一条智能发布流水线:

  1. 录制基础模板:录制一次完整的发布流程
  2. 参数化调整:将平台特定的元素(如标签、描述)设为变量
  3. 批量执行:设置脚本按顺序在不同平台执行
  4. 质量检查:添加截图和验证步骤确保发布成功

效果评估:原本需要45分钟的手动发布流程,现在只需5分钟启动,然后让计算机自动完成剩余工作。

场景二:数据分析师的报表自动化工厂

对于需要定期生成报表的数据分析师,KeymouseGo可以搭建一个完整的报表生成系统:

  1. 数据提取:自动化登录数据库系统,执行查询
  2. 数据处理:在Excel或数据处理软件中执行标准化操作
  3. 格式调整:自动应用模板格式,添加图表
  4. 分发归档:将最终报表保存到指定位置,发送给相关人员

效率提升:月度报表从8小时手动工作减少到30分钟监督时间,准确率提升至100%。

场景三:开发者的测试自动化沙盒

开发者在进行界面测试时,经常需要重复相同的操作序列。KeymouseGo可以:

  1. 录制测试用例:录制用户操作流程作为测试脚本
  2. 创建测试套件:将多个测试脚本组织成测试套件
  3. 自动化回归测试:每次代码变更后自动运行测试
  4. 生成测试报告:记录测试结果和截图

质量保证:确保每次更新不会破坏现有功能,大幅减少手动测试时间。

高级技巧:从用户到自动化架构师

技巧一:脚本优化与性能调优

生成的脚本虽然可用,但往往不是最优的。通过手动编辑,你可以:

  • 减少不必要的延迟:分析脚本中的等待时间,去除冗余
  • 合并连续操作:将多个相似操作合并为更高效的序列
  • 添加错误处理:在关键步骤后添加验证点
  • 创建模块化脚本:将常用操作封装为可重用的模块

技巧二:环境适应性与兼容性设计

确保脚本在不同环境下都能稳定运行:

  • 使用相对路径:避免硬编码绝对路径
  • 添加环境检测:在脚本开始前检查必要的条件
  • 创建配置层:将环境相关的设置外部化
  • 实现降级策略:当自动化失败时提供手动操作指南

技巧三:监控、日志与异常处理

成熟的自动化系统需要完善的监控机制:

  • 执行日志:记录每次脚本执行的时间、结果和异常
  • 性能指标:跟踪执行时间、成功率等关键指标
  • 异常处理:定义当自动化失败时的恢复策略
  • 通知机制:在关键事件发生时发送通知

架构解析:理解自动化引擎的内部工作原理

KeymouseGo的架构设计体现了模块化思想,每个组件都有明确的职责:

KeymouseGo/ ├── KeymouseGo.py # 主程序入口,协调各模块工作 ├── Event/ # 事件处理核心,负责动作的录制和回放 │ ├── Event.py # 基础事件类定义,构建自动化动作的原子单位 │ ├── UniversalEvents.py # 跨平台通用事件实现,确保多系统兼容性 │ └── WindowsEvents.py # Windows特定事件优化,提供最佳性能 ├── Recorder/ # 录制功能模块,捕获用户操作的精髓 │ ├── UniversalRecorder.py # 通用录制器,支持多种输入设备 │ └── WindowsRecorder.py # Windows录制器,针对Windows系统优化 ├── Plugin/ # 插件系统,提供无限扩展可能 │ ├── Interface.py # 插件接口定义,规范扩展开发 │ └── Manager.py # 插件管理器,协调插件加载和执行 ├── Util/ # 工具函数模块,提供各种实用功能 │ ├── ClickedLabel.py # 界面交互组件,增强用户体验 │ ├── Global.py # 全局配置管理,统一系统设置 │ ├── Parser.py # 脚本解析器,处理JSON5格式脚本 │ └── RunScriptClass.py # 脚本运行类,执行自动化流程

这种分层架构使得KeymouseGo既保持了核心功能的稳定性,又为扩展提供了灵活的基础。插件系统特别值得关注——它允许开发者创建自定义功能,如图像识别、OCR集成或API连接,从而将简单的鼠标键盘录制升级为智能自动化系统。

效率革命的下一步:你的自动化转型路线图

第一阶段:意识觉醒(第1周)

  • 识别日常工作中的重复性任务
  • 记录每个任务消耗的时间
  • 选择1-2个最适合自动化的任务开始
  • 安装KeymouseGo并创建第一个脚本

第二阶段:技能掌握(第2-4周)

  • 深入学习脚本编辑技巧
  • 创建3-5个常用自动化脚本
  • 尝试跨应用的工作流自动化
  • 建立脚本库和文档系统

第三阶段:系统构建(第2-3个月)

  • 设计完整的自动化工作流程
  • 集成系统调度和监控
  • 开发自定义插件扩展功能
  • 建立团队共享的自动化资产

第四阶段:文化转型(持续进行)

  • 将自动化思维融入日常工作
  • 培训团队成员使用自动化工具
  • 建立自动化最佳实践指南
  • 持续优化和改进自动化系统

立即行动:你的5天自动化启动计划

第一天:环境准备

  • 克隆项目仓库:git clone https://gitcode.com/gh_mirrors/ke/KeymouseGo
  • 安装Python依赖:pip install -r requirements-universal.txt
  • 启动主程序:python KeymouseGo.py
  • 熟悉界面布局和基本操作

第二天:第一个自动化脚本

  • 选择一个简单的重复任务
  • 录制完整的操作流程
  • 测试脚本的正确性
  • 计算节省的时间

第三天:脚本优化

  • 学习JSON5脚本格式
  • 优化脚本中的时间延迟
  • 添加注释和文档
  • 创建脚本备份策略

第四天:工作流整合

  • 识别可以串联的多个任务
  • 创建复合型自动化工作流
  • 设置定时执行
  • 测试跨日期的稳定性

第五天:扩展与分享

  • 探索插件系统的可能性
  • 与团队成员分享自动化经验
  • 制定长期的自动化改进计划
  • 加入开源社区贡献想法

自动化不是终点,而是效率革命的起点。KeymouseGo提供的不仅是一个工具,更是一种思维方式——将重复性工作交给计算机,将创造性工作留给自己。每一次自动化,都是对未来的投资;每一次效率提升,都是对生命的尊重。

现在,是时候按下那个录制键,开始你的自动化之旅了。让机器处理重复,让你专注于创造。在数字时代,真正的竞争优势不是工作更努力,而是工作更智能。KeymouseGo正是帮助你实现这一转变的关键工具。

【免费下载链接】KeymouseGo类似按键精灵的鼠标键盘录制和自动化操作 模拟点击和键入 | automate mouse clicks and keyboard input项目地址: https://gitcode.com/gh_mirrors/ke/KeymouseGo

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.gsyq.cn/news/1455892.html

相关文章:

  • Nintendo Switch帧率解锁终极指南:FPSLocker深度配置与实战优化
  • 【分享】360DNS优选 v5.0.0.1 网络加速DNS优化工具
  • 如何用Boss Show Time插件一键查看所有招聘岗位的发布时间
  • DIY蓝牙音箱:从TP4056充电管理到激光切割外壳的完整制作指南
  • 2026 年 6 月PPH风管优质生产厂家推荐指南|PPH管 / PP板材 厂家优选 - 多才菠萝
  • OBS Studio终极指南:免费开源直播软件从入门到精通
  • Beyond Compare 5密钥生成实战手册:3分钟获取永久授权
  • 基于Arduino与红外传感器的自动足部消毒器DIY全攻略
  • 2026上海厨房漏水、墙面返潮发霉?专业堵漏根治靠谱商家推荐 - 苏易修缮
  • 上海阳台漏水渗水怎么处理?2026本地正规防水修缮哪家好 - 苏易修缮
  • 2026上海梅雨季+台风季漏水高发!厨卫、楼顶、外墙防潮堵漏根治方法 - 苏易修缮
  • 7个简单步骤:让你的浏览器成为多语言翻译神器
  • 内河拖船定制厂家推荐 - 舒雯文化
  • 2026 温州免砸砖防水、外墙、地下室、楼顶渗漏 + 彩钢瓦、阳光房漏水 本地专业防水公司 TOP5 权威推荐(2026 年 6 月本地最新深度调研) - 吉林同城获客
  • 你的聊天工具该升级了——2026 企业 IM 三大趋势
  • 零基础转行AI大模型:程序员必备的“新出路”,高薪收藏攻略!
  • DIY可编程ARGB六边形灯板:从WS2812B原理到主板控制全解析
  • 常州家里瓷砖空鼓,翘边怎么修?2026瓷砖空鼓专业维修公司TOP5服务商专业性解析,卫生间空鼓翘边,厨房空鼓翘边,客厅空鼓翘边,最新深度调研解析 - 防水资讯
  • 盐城家里瓷砖空鼓,翘边怎么修?2026瓷砖空鼓专业维修公司TOP5服务商专业性解析,卫生间空鼓翘边,厨房空鼓翘边,客厅空鼓翘边,最新深度调研解析 - 防水资讯
  • PyPYLON终极指南:如何用Python快速实现工业相机控制与机器视觉应用
  • 【Azure App Service】应用服务中的源网络地址转化(SNAT: Source Network Address Transfer)
  • G-Helper终极指南:华硕笔记本轻量级控制工具完全使用教程
  • 别只顾着写代码:AI 时代 Builder 的「词元经济学」与成本自查清单
  • 终极浏览器音乐解锁指南:10分钟让加密音乐重获自由 [特殊字符]
  • 手把手教你用Python的classification_report:从混淆矩阵到业务报告,避坑指南全在这
  • 别再傻傻用put了!Java Map的compute三兄弟(compute/computeIfAbsent/computeIfPresent)保姆级使用指南
  • 解放小爱音箱:用XiaoMusic打造你的专属智能音乐管家
  • 5分钟掌握AI金融分析:TradingAgents-CN多智能体股票分析平台完全指南
  • 2026上海卫生间漏水怎么办?微创补漏维修哪家公司靠谱 - 苏易修缮
  • 革命性NLP预训练模型electra-small-discriminator:用判别器革新文本编码的终极指南